An Advanced Certificate in Sensory Disabilities Support equips individuals with the advanced knowledge and practical skills necessary to support individuals with visual, auditory, or other sensory impairments. The program focuses on person-centered approaches and inclusive practices.
Learning outcomes typically include mastering effective communication strategies for diverse sensory needs, understanding assistive technologies and their applications, and developing proficiency in creating inclusive environments. Students also gain expertise in sensory integration techniques and strategies for managing challenging behaviors associated with sensory processing difficulties. An Advanced Certificate in Sensory Disabilities Support is increasingly significant in today's UK market. The aging population and rising awareness of inclusive practices are driving demand for skilled professionals. The UK has a substantial population affected by sensory impairments; for instance, the Royal National Institute of Blind People (RNIB) estimates over two million people in the UK are living with sight loss. Similarly, Action on Hearing Loss reports millions more experiencing hearing difficulties. This creates a considerable need for support workers with specialized knowledge and skills.
